    OTN and Router Interface Types

    An optical transport network (OTN) is a digital wrapper that encapsulates frames of data, to allow multiple data sources to be sent on the same channel. This creates an optical virtual private network for each client signal. ITU-T defines an optical transport network as a set of optical network elements (ONE) connected by optical fiber links, able to provide functionality of transport, multiplexing, swit.     Gas detectors are divided into optical and other types

    What are the main types of gas detectors? The main types of gas detectors include electrochemical, infrared (IR), catalytic bead, and photoionization detectors (PID). Each type of detector is designed for specific applications, environments, and gas types. Choosing the right one requires a clear understanding of how they work and what they are best suited for. Gas detectors are safety devices designed to monitor and measure the concentration of gases in an area. They alert individuals or automatically activate safety protocols when gas levels exceed a safe threshold.
